What West Hanover Township weather means for your home

West Hanover Township sits in a region that experiences significant precipitation throughout the year. With over 40 inches of annual rainfall and heavy downpours concentrated from April through August, properly functioning gutters are essential to keep water away from your foundation and basement. The summer months bring intense thunderstorms that test gutter capacity, and inadequate drainage during these periods leads directly to water intrusion, soil erosion around your home, and costly foundation repairs.

Winter weather in West Hanover compounds gutter stress. Temperatures regularly drop below freezing from November through March, creating freeze-thaw cycles that expand and contract your gutters, weaken seams, and promote ice dam formation on roof edges. When gutters fail in winter, ice and snow melt back up under shingles, leaking into attic spaces and interior walls. Combined with the region's significant snowfall, unprotected gutters leave your home vulnerable to structural damage that doesn't show up until spring thaw reveals the cost.

How long does gutter installation take?

A typical single-story residential installation takes one to three days, depending on your home's size, roof complexity, and current gutter condition. Our local crews will provide a specific timeline during your quote.
